What Does This Mean?
Based on aggregated statistical analysis, approximately 2,623 people in the United States are estimated to share the name Chancellor.
To make this easier to understand, this means that about 1 out of every 125,810 people has this name.
This classification places Chancellor in the Very Rare category compared to other names nationwide.
